Ubisoft’s Rainbow Six Siege suffered a catastrophic security breach. Hackers flooded player accounts with roughly 2 billion R6 Credits in a massive cyberattack. The incident forced Ubisoft to take all game servers offline on December 27, 2025.

This is one of the most severe breaches in competitive gaming history. The attack exposed critical backend systems and player data, according to security researchers.
Details of the Massive Security Breach
The hackers gained deep administrative access to Ubisoft’s systems. They distributed enormous sums of in-game currency as a visible sign of their control. The breach affected all platforms simultaneously, including PC, PlayStation, and Xbox.
Reports from BleepingComputer indicate source code and developer tools were accessed. Multiple coordinated hacker groups appear responsible for the sophisticated attack.
Ubisoft’s security team initiated an emergency server shutdown within hours. This drastic action aimed to prevent further unauthorized access and data theft.
Ubisoft’s Emergency Response and Investigation
The company launched a full-scale forensic investigation immediately. Their priority is determining the full scope of compromised player information. No specific timeline for servers returning online has been provided.
Initial findings point to exploited authentication vulnerabilities. Ubisoft is implementing substantial security patches before considering a restart.
This process could take several days, experts suggest. The company is communicating directly with the player community through official channels.
Impact on Millions of Players Worldwide
Millions of players face uncertainty about their accounts and purchases. Illegally distributed credits complicate standard account rollback procedures. Legitimate player progress and cosmetic items may be affected.
The breach raises serious concerns about data safety in online gaming. Players who enabled two-factor authentication had better protection.
Many are advised to change passwords once services resume. They should also monitor financial statements linked to their Ubisoft accounts.

What should affected Rainbow Six Siege players do now?
Players should monitor official Ubisoft communications closely. Avoid clicking any suspicious links claiming to offer fixes. Enable two-factor authentication on your account when services return.
When will Rainbow Six Siege servers come back online?
Ubisoft has not announced a specific return date. Security experts estimate a minimum of 48-72 hours for initial fixes. The process may take longer due to the breach’s severity.
Was my personal payment information stolen in this hack?
Ubisoft’s investigation is ongoing to determine what data was accessed. The company states it takes data privacy extremely seriously. Players should review statements from their payment providers as a precaution.
Will the illegitimately added R6 Credits be removed?
Ubisoft will almost certainly roll back the fraudulently distributed currency. The technical process for this is complex across millions of accounts. Legitimate player purchases should be restored.
How did hackers breach Ubisoft’s security systems?
Initial reports point to exploited authentication vulnerabilities. The attackers likely used a multi-pronged approach to gain backend access. A full technical explanation will come from Ubisoft’s investigation.
